Abstract

The invention discloses an efficient squeezing device for high-purity oxalic acid serving as textile dyeing and finishing auxiliaries. The efficient squeezing device comprises a supporting plate; thetop of the supporting plate is fixedly connected with storing plates, and through holes are formed in the bottoms of the storing plates; the two sides of the supporting plate are fixedly connected with supporting frames and positioning plates correspondingly; the bottoms of the positioning plates are fixedly connected with the tops of the supporting frames; and a fixed plate is arranged on the topof the supporting plate. Through matched use of the supporting plate, the storing plates, the supporting frames, the positioning plates, the fixed plate, motors, winding wheels, ropes, a mounting block, connecting blocks, clamping hooks, an air cylinder, a connecting shaft, squeezing cylinders, sleeves and a material receiving box, the problem that an existing squeezing device is low in working efficiency during using is solved; and the efficient squeezing device for the high-purity oxalic acid serving as the textile dyeing and finishing auxiliaries has the advantage of high efficiency, the squeezing time is shortened, and labor force of a user is reduced.
